Wound up with some wooly fingers but the jute is in the car. Today we start on the carpet and have a few questions, so jump in here if you can, you too Alan, since you are the expert!

With the carpet that goes behind the seats, what do you do when you get to the door latch? Looking at the CD, it looks like you covor the latch with the carpet, instead of trimming the carpet around it?

Also, there are two small pieces of black vinyl, is this for the door hinges?

I cover the striker with carpet then trim around the striker catch, you don't have to cover it but I do. You might have to peel the carpet back if the striker has to be adjusted later and yes the vinyl is for the hinges. Have fun and don't shiff too much glue.

Bitten,

I removed the latch assy,glued the carpet down,installed the latch assy. over the carpet and tightened,cut around it with a razor blade,removed the latch assy.,removed the carpet piece, and installed the latch assy.
It looks clean and neat.
